ناطرين/Natreen - Danish Refugee Council Photo Exhibition by Leila Alaoui
The Danish Refugee Council (DRC) is pleased to announce the opening reception of the photography exhibition "ناطرين/Natreen” on Friday November 29th from 6 to 9pm at Station Beirut.
Sponsored by the European Commission Humanitarian Aid and Civil Protection Department (ECHO), the exhibition showcases portraits of displaced Syrians in Lebanon.
